"Fed's Aggressive Stance Sparks $439M Outflow from Crypto ETFs as Bitcoin and Ethereum Suffer Losses"

- Fed's hawkish policy triggered $439M net outflows from Bitcoin and Ethereum ETFs in recent weeks. - Spot BTC ETFs recorded -648 BTC net outflow on Sept 2, while ETH ETFs lost 11,731 ETH ($51M). - Centralized exchanges saw 2,600 BTC net inflow (Binance led), contrasting with ETF outflows and bearish price forecasts. - Market analysts link ETF withdrawals to Fed rate uncertainty, with Ethereum facing pressure to outperform Bitcoin.
